Output 1029c2051aa6e105a486b66356a876c1785b23c531ca8db6c1d6378e40d11a61:3

value
10531000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fa01f01584b90a178f9b1695d3cd3fd61f3751 OP_EQUAL
address
MJCXQkCfpQ6tfL5rxYWsCjdxw5UPW9XAFC
transaction
1029c2051aa6e105a486b66356a876c1785b23c531ca8db6c1d6378e40d11a61
spent
true